What’s a cooperative organization?

Respuesta :

reynoldsrichard
reynoldsrichard reynoldsrichard
  • 04-05-2019

A cooperative is a private business organization that is owned and controlled by the people who use its products, supplies or services. Although cooperatives vary in type and membership size, all were formed to meet the specific objectives of members, and are structured to adapt to member's changing needs.
